Rafa Benitez has spoken about the professionalism and character of Sami Hyypia as, if picked, he prepares to play his 700th game for Liverpool against Stoke at the week-end. The big Finn has started in 5 of the last 6 games, due to Carra playing RB because of injury to Arbeloa, and has played well in those games.
Rafa said:
"I have a lot of confidence in Sami, he is a fantastic professional so I knew he would play really well".
"Clearly, when you talk about Sami you are talking about a player who has been here for a long time.
"Everybody knows he is a nice lad, a very good professional and a very good player, so we are really pleased to keep him here.
"We have very good centre-backs here and it is good to see all of them competing for a place. That can only be good for the team."
